- Title
Determination of the heat storage performance of thermochemical heat storage materials based on SrCl<sub>2</sub> and MgSO<sub>4</sub>.
- Authors
Posern, K.; Osburg, A.
- Abstract
Composite materials with salt hydrates are promising materials for thermochemical heat storage applications. Besides the determination of the isothermal heat of sorption of the storage materials, the temperature lift of a sorption process is a major key factor. The aim of this paper is the comparison of the heat of sorption with the temperature lift, measured in a laboratory-scaled storage. The measurements of the isothermal heat of sorption were taken by humidity controlled calorimetry. The materials for the investigations were salt pellets of SrCl2 and MgSO4 and composite materials that contain both salts. It could be found that SrCl2 has a high potential as an active substance in composite materials for thermochemical heat storage, due to a low temperature of dehydration and the reversibility of the dehydration and hydration. The host material for the salt hydrates was activated carbon, which has a strong influence on the kinetic of the sorption and the temperature lift, respectively.
